TY - BOOK AU - Alencar, P. PY - 2004 DA - 2004// TI - A Query-Based Approach for Aspect Measurement and Analysis PB - School of Computer Science, University of Waterloo CY - Canada ID - Alencar2004 ER - TY - STD TI - AspectJ Team. The AspectJ Programming Guide. http://eclipse.org/aspectj/, December 2003. ID - ref2 ER - TY - JOUR AU - Basili, V. AU - Selby, R. AU - Hutchins, D. PY - 1986 DA - 1986// TI - Experimentation in Software Engineering JO - IEEE Transactions on Software Engineering VL - 12 ID - Basili1986 ER - TY - JOUR AU - Chidamber, S. AU - Kemerer, C. PY - 1994 DA - 1994// TI - A Metrics Suite for Object Oriented Design JO - IEEE Transactions on Software Engineering VL - 20 UR - https://doi.org/10.1109/32.295895 DO - 10.1109/32.295895 ID - Chidamber1994 ER - TY - BOOK AU - Fenton, N. AU - Pfleeger, S. PY - 1997 DA - 1997// TI - Software Metrics: A Rigorous Practical Approach PB - PWS CY - London ID - Fenton1997 ER - TY - BOOK AU - Gamma, E. PY - 1995 DA - 1995// TI - Design Patterns: Elements of Reusable Object-Oriented Software PB - Addison-Wesley CY - Reading ID - Gamma1995 ER - TY - BOOK AU - Garcia, A. PY - 2004 DA - 2004// TI - From Objects to Agents: An Aspect-Oriented Approach PB - PUC-Rio, Computer Science Department CY - Rio de Janeiro, Brazil ID - Garcia2004 ER - TY - STD TI - A. Garcia et al. Separation of Concerns in Multi-Agent Systems: An Empirical Study. In C. Lucena et al (eds.)Software Engineering for Multi-Agent Systems II, pages 49–71, Springer, LNCS 2940, January 2004. ID - ref8 ER - TY - JOUR AU - Garcia, A. AU - Silva, V. AU - Chavez, C. AU - Lucena, C. PY - 2002 DA - 2002// TI - Engineering Multi-Agent Systems with Aspects and Patterns JO - Journal of the Brazilian Computer Society VL - 1 ID - Garcia2002 ER - TY - STD TI - J. Hannemann, G. Kiczales. Design Pattern Implementation in Java and AspectJ. InProceedings of OOPSLA’02, pages 161–173, November 2002. ID - ref10 ER - TY - STD TI - B. Henderson-Sellers. Object-Oriented Metrics: Measures of Complexity. Prentice Hall, 1996. ID - ref11 ER - TY - STD TI - Java Reference Documentation. http://java.sun.com/reference/docs/index.html, February 2004. ID - ref12 ER - TY - STD TI - A. Kersten, G. Murphy. Atlas: A Case Study in Building a Web-based learning environment using aspect-oriented programming. InProceedings of OOPSLA’99, pages 340–352, November 1999. ID - ref13 ER - TY - CHAP AU - Kiczales, G. PY - 1997 DA - 1997// TI - Aspect-Oriented Programming BT - Proceedings of ECOOP’97, LNCS (1241) PB - Springer-Verlag CY - Finland ID - Kiczales1997 ER - TY - JOUR AU - Kitchenham, B. PY - 1996 DA - 1996// TI - Evaluating Software Engineering methods and tools, Part 1: The Evaluation Context and Evaluation Methods JO - ACM SIGSOFT Software Engineering Notes VL - 21 UR - https://doi.org/10.1145/381790.381795 DO - 10.1145/381790.381795 ID - Kitchenham1996 ER - TY - STD TI - M. Lippert, C. Lopes. A Study on Exception Detection and Handling Using Aspect-Oriented Programming. InProceedings of ICSE’00, pages 418–427, May 2000. ID - ref16 ER - TY - STD TI - C. Lopes. D: A Language Framework for Distributed Programming. PhD Thesis, Northeastern University, 1997. ID - ref17 ER - TY - STD TI - C. Sant’Anna. Maintainability and Reusability of Aspect-Oriented Software: An Assessment Framework. Masters Thesis, PUC-Rio, March 2004 (in Portuguese). ID - ref18 ER - TY - STD TI - C. Sant’Anna et al. On the Reuse and Maintenance of Aspect-Oriented Software: An Assessment Framework. InProceedings of the 17o Brazilian Symposium on Software Engineering, pages 19–34, October 2003. ID - ref19 ER - TY - STD TI - S. Soares, E. Laureano, P. Borba. Implementing Distribution and Persistence Aspects with AspectJ. InProceedings of OOPSLA’02, pages 174–190, 2002. ID - ref20 ER - TY - STD TI - P. Tarr et al. N Degrees of Separation: Multi-Dimensional Separation of Concerns. InProceedings of ICSE’99, pp. 107–119, May 1999. ID - ref21 ER - TY - STD TI - R. Walker, E. Baniassad, G. Murphy. An Initial Assessment of Aspect-oriented Programming. InProceedings of ICSE’99, pages 120–130, May 1999. ID - ref22 ER -